POSITION SUMMARY:   

Under minimal supervision, the ProPath Career Progression Manager is responsible for overseeing, monitoring, and supporting the effective implementation of the ProPath career progression program at Ft. Bliss. Employees in this job class serve as the primary program resource for Operations, Rehabilitation Services, site Points of Contact (POCs), managers, and supervisors by providing program oversight, training, technical assistance, and ongoing monitoring of employee career progression documentation and activities. This job class requires knowledge of rehabilitation best practices, career development frameworks, data tracking and reporting systems, and the ability to collaborate with cross-functional stakeholders to promote accountability, consistency, and continuous improvement.

 

TYPICAL DUTIES:  

1. *Provides complete oversight and monitoring of the ProPath career progression program at Ft. Bliss, ensuring consistent implementation and adherence to established standards.
2. *Monitors completion of ProPath skills checklists, job assessments, career plans, and required documentation.
3. *Tracks program progress and trends using Power BI dashboards and reporting tools; analyzes data to identify gaps, risks, and opportunities for improvement.
4. *Follows up with managers, supervisors, and site POCs regarding incomplete or overdue ProPath requirements and supports resolution.
5. *Serves as the primary point of contact for ProPath-related questions, guidance, and communication, including monitoring and responding to the ProPath email account.
6. *Develops, delivers, and maintains training programs, onboarding sessions, and refresher trainings for Operations leadership, Rehabilitation Counselors, supervisors, and POCs.
7. *Provides ongoing technical assistance and coaching to stakeholders to support effective use of ProPath tools, forms, and processes.
8. *Develops and updates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), training materials, job aids, and program resources to support consistency and scalability.
9. *Collaborates with Rehabilitation Counselors, Operations leadership, and other stakeholders to promote employee engagement, accountability, and adoption of career progression practices.
10. Performs other duties and special projects as assigned
 

* Denotes Essential Job Function
